What is a Lightweight Folding Wheelchair?

A lightweight folding wheelchair is a movement help designed for ease of transport and use. Normally made from lightweight products such as aluminum or titanium, these wheelchairs are intended for people who need assistance with movement but require a device that can be quickly folded and stored. The ingenious design permits it to be folded down to a compact size, making it practical for travel, storage, and everyday use.

Key Features of Lightweight Folding Wheelchairs

  1. Weight: One of the most considerable advantages is their lightweight nature, typically varying from 15 to 40 pounds.
  2. Foldability: These wheelchairs can be quickly folded with one hand, which is perfect for users who might have restricted upper body strength.
  3. Resilience: Made from premium materials, while still being lightweight, these wheelchairs endure everyday usage.
  4. Compact Design: When folded, they occupy minimal space, making them easy to fit in car trunks or storage areas.
  5. Range of Accessories: Many designs feature adjustable footrests, armrests, and seat cushions for enhanced comfort.
  6. Wheels: Many lightweight folding wheelchairs include quick-release wheels, even more helping mobility.

Choosing the Right Lightweight Folding Wheelchair

Selecting the ideal lightweight folding wheelchair includes thinking about numerous elements. Here is a detailed list of elements to represent:

  1. User's Weight and Size: Ensure the wheelchair accommodates the user's weight and body measurements. Most folding wheelchairs specify weight limits.
  2. Product: Look for durable materials like aluminum or titanium, which optimize both weight and toughness.
  3. Seat Width and Depth: The seat should be comfy and appropriately sized to avoid slipping or pain.
  4. Type of Terrain: Consider whether the wheelchair will be generally used indoors or outdoors. Certain designs are chosen for rugged terrain, featuring bigger wheels or all-terrain abilities.
  5. Storage Options: Evaluate whether a wheelchair with storage alternatives is needed to hold personal possessions.
  6. Rate: Determine a budget plan and search for models within that range, weighing costs against the functions used.
  7. Warranty and Service: Look for warranties or service strategies to make sure that the investment is secured.

2. Can you utilize a lightweight folding wheelchair outdoors?

Yes! Many lightweight folding wheelchairs are developed for both indoor and outside usage. Nevertheless, constantly pick a design with wheels matched for rugged terrain if you plan to use it outside regularly.

3. Are lightweight folding wheelchairs easy to store?

Definitely! They can be easily folded down to a compact size, making storage in tight spaces, such as cars and truck trunks or closets, really convenient.

4. Do lightweight folding wheelchairs require upkeep?

Like all mobility help, regular upkeep is recommended. Occasionally examine the tires, brakes, and folding systems to guarantee they work efficiently.

5. Can lightweight folding wheelchairs be tailored?

Numerous designs provide personalization choices, such as seat cushions, armrest types, and storage bags to suit specific user choices.
